Own your future
Our culture isn’t something people join, it’s something they build and shape. We believe that every person deserves to be heard and empowered. If you’re on the fence about whether you’re a fit, we say go for it. Let’s build something great together.
Must haves
- Proficient with Swift.
- Knowledge of the Apple iOS ecosystem and the libraries available for common tasks.
- Experience with offline storage, threading, and performance tuning.
- Familiarity with cloud message APIs and push notifications.
- Understanding of Apple’s design principles and interface guidelines.
- Familiarity with RESTful APIs to connect iOS applications to back-end services.
- Experience with iOS frameworks such as Core Data, Core Animation, etc.
- Proficient understanding of code versioning tools, such as Git.
- Upper-intermediate level of English.
As a plus
- Working knowledge of the general mobile landscape, architectures, trends, and emerging technologies.
- Solid understanding of the full mobile development life cycle.
- Experience of setting up the CI/CD pipelines.
Key responsibilities
- Design and build advanced applications for the iOS platform.
- Ensure the performance, quality, and responsiveness of applications.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Work with outside data sources and APIs.
- Continuously discover, evaluate, and implement new technologies to maximize development efficiency.
- Drive engineering from concept to finished product.